HOW IT WORKS
Native Inference changes where inference runs - not how your applications connect. Here is what that means for your architecture, your capacity and your costs.
01
ARCHITECTURE
Chat and generation, embeddings, reranking, vision and speech normally mean a separate provider and endpoint for each one. In 12.2 they all run inside SearchAI, on hardware you own - so nothing leaves your network, and there are no keys or per-token costs to manage.

02
CAPACITY
Real work runs on the CPUs you already have - grounded answers, summarization, extraction, function calling, vision and speech. When more people and more applications arrive, cluster mode spreads that work across additional nodes. An NVIDIA GPU is an option, not a requirement.

03
COST
Your inference cost is the hardware you run - and that is the whole bill. It does not move when usage doubles, when an agent loops, or when someone summarizes a long document. There is no token meter running in the background, so your cost stays predictable as adoption grows.

EXTRACTED FIELDS
Understands photos, forms, charts and video
Ask about a chart in a report, a field on a form, a product photo or a moment in a video, and get an answer based on what the image actually shows. Point it at a pile of forms and the same reading comes back as fields - the invoice number, the date, the name - ready for whatever system needs them.
IMAGE UNDERSTANDING
Reads images in milliseconds
Gemma 4 understands images natively. Its 12B model takes about 19 ms to read an image, so visual questions do not slow the conversation down.
DESCRIPTION AND IMAGE SEARCH
Search text and images together
Every image is described and tagged as it arrives, so words and pictures live in the same search index and one question can return the right photo alongside the right paragraph. A reranker then puts the best matches first - all on a single server.
MODEL CHOICE
Choose the right vision model
Pick the model that fits your hardware and quality needs: Qwen 3.5 (2B up to 35B), Qwen 3.8 27B or Gemma 4 (E2B up to 26B).
Beyond text and images, the same endpoint your applications already call can listen, speak, use your tools and think through harder problems.
Speech
Turn recordings into text, read answers out loud, and create a voice from an audio sample.
Takes action with your tools
Let the AI call your systems to get things done. It works with every model, connects to MCP clients, and can return clean JSON your apps can use straight away.
Thinks harder when needed
For tougher questions, the model can reason longer before it answers. You choose how much effort to spend (Qwen 3.8 and Spark X2.5).
Try it before you build
A built-in console with 380 ready-made prompts across 13 industries, side-by-side model comparisons, and a Prompt Optimizer that suggests better prompts in one click.
Secure and predictable
HTTPS and API keys are built in. The same question gets the same answer, and every response shows how long it took.
Easy to scale out
Add servers and they find each other automatically - no extra load balancer to set up. Each request goes to the server that has the right model, is least busy, and already holds the conversation.
